
Day before the official Galaxy S III announcement we receive something that can actually tell us how big the next Galaxy is going to be. If you recall, there was a rumor that the Galaxy S III smart-phone should have a 4.8-inch touch-screen display. Well, if Samsung hasn’t changed everything in the last moment, this is really true. What you can see on the image is the first screen protector for the S III seen in the wild. The "Ultimate Screen Guard" is laser cut and can give us a clue as to what the size and shape of the display will be on the Samsung Galaxy S III. To make sure that this screen protector was not made for the previous Galaxies, it was compared with the Galaxy S II and Galaxy Nexus. Both smart-phones seem to be too small to fit perfectly well into the protector. And as far as the Galaxy Nexus with its 4.65-inch screen is too small for the accessory, it looks like 4.8-inch touch-screen it is.
